Just did the tennis ball thing a couple of times in the evening (which sounds proper dodgy!). Being a patronising old git think about just spending some £££ on seeing a good sports physio as soon as you think you've proper hurt something, and maybe ask for a bit of an MOT. After seeing a couple of naff ones I found a good un who understood the types of training we do or want to be doing, and bingo at the moment everything is working pain free.
